    Abstract: The present disclosure discloses an electric lifting media wall, comprising a base, a lifting component including at least one group of lifting columns with lower ends connected to the base and a drive mechanism driving the lifting columns to ascend or descend, a support frame for connection with a display mounting rack that is connected to the lifting columns and ascends or descends along with the lifting columns synchronously, and a wall shroud that shrouds outside the lifting component and the support frame. The electric lifting media wall is adjustable in height, high in bearing capability, multifunctional, convenient in assembly and disassembly, easy for later maintenance, and small in package size.

    Abstract: The present disclosure discloses an exercise bicycle with a desk plate, which comprises a frame, a supporting foot, a seat and a desk plate, the frame including a first upright column to support the desk plate and a second upright column to support the seat, wherein a first lifting assembly is provided on the first upright column to connect the desk plate and the first upright column, and enables the adjustment of the upper and lower positions of the desk plate relative to the first upright column. The height of the desk plate can be adjusted by the first lifting assembly to accommodate users with different figures. It's more ergonomic since the height of the upright column supporting the desk plate can be adjusted. When packing, lower the upright column to the minimum can largely reduce the size of the package.

    Abstract: The present disclosure discloses a desk-mounted lifting platform comprising a workbench, an upper support and a low support. The workbench is connected to the upper support. A first lifting arm and a second lifting arm are arranged between the upper support and the lower support. The first lifting arm and the second lifting arm are X-shaped and hinged at an intersection thereof. An upper end of the first lifting arm is hinged with the upper support. A lower end of the first lifting arm is slidably fitted on the lower support. A lower end of the second lifting arm is hinged with the lower support. An upper end of the second lifting arm is slidably fitted on the upper support. A gas spring is arranged between the upper support and the lower support. The gas spring is used for providing a lifting force to lift the upper support.

    Abstract: The invention provides a lifting desk control method including a motor drive unit, a current detection unit and an arithmetic unit. The control method comprises the steps of: detecting current a at the current time t1 and current b at time t2; calculating the current change rate L=(b?a)/(t2?t1); and comparing L with a set value, judging that an obstacle is encountered if the set value is exceeded, and issuing a stopping or retreating instruction to a motor by the motor drive unit. The scheme employed by the invention is to calculate the change rate of current, so judgment is made with higher accuracy and whether an obstacle is encountered is judged with high sensitivity.

    Abstract: An electric shelf is provided which comprises at least one column to be installed on a wall, a slidable component arranged on the column to slide along the column vertically, at least one layer of shelf board component connected to the slidable component to move simultaneously with the slidable component, and a linear driving device connected to the slidable component and the column to actuate the slidable component to move relative to the column. Advantages of the present disclosure compared to prior arts include a simpler structure and less space occupied by the shelf board component.

    Abstract: The embodiments of the present disclosure disclose a clamping device for continuous adjustment of a display stand which comprises a holder having an upper pressing board and a side board, a connector connected to the side board having at least one connecting column, and a fastening screw screwed to the connector with a gap formed between the top of the fastening screw and the bottom of the upper pressing board. The side board comprises connecting holes and channels which allow adjusting the height of the display stand without having to disassemble the connector.
